Course content


• Introduction to Cybersecurity in Software Engineering

• Network Security Fundamentals

• Cryptography and Encryption Techniques

• Threat Intelligence and Vulnerability Assessment

• Secure Coding Practices and Secure Development Life Cycle

• Incident Response and Disaster Recovery

• Cloud Security and Virtualization

• Artificial Intelligence and Machine Learning in Cybersecurity

• Cybersecurity Law and Ethics

• Penetration Testing and Red Team Exercises
